Ann Sindone Sheehan

January 29, 1949 — April 4, 2022

Age 73, passed away on April 4, 2022 at Arnot Ogden Medical Center after a terrible bout with blood cancer. She was born in Elmira, NY, daughter of the late Edward and Pauline (James) Sindone and predeceased by younger sister Angie and grandson Tyler Carey.

Ann is survived by Jack, her husband of 50 plus years and their children; daughter Kim with husband Chris and children Mary Jane, Jack and Dominic; son Donald with children Dia and Johnny; daughter Karen with husband Bob and children Corrin and Grace; son Brian with wife Shannon and children Joe, Mallory and Danielle (Leah, Gabe and Luka); son Luke with wife Jenna and children Luke, Trey and Naomi; son Christopher with wife Gabriela and children Sofia, Leo, Felix and Veronica. Ann is survived by her sisters Mary and Stella, brothers Chris and John.
Ann was beloved by too many family and friends to mention. She was the center of the family and was known for her famous lasagna. Ann was fun loving and a very generous person. She was a great card player and loved taking trips to the casino and bringing home all of her winnings. Some of her favorite times were spent traveling to Florida to spend time with family.

Ann will be greatly missed by many. There will be no calling hours per her wishes. Family and friends are invited to attend Ann's Mass of Christian Burial at St. Patrick's Church, 604 Park Place, Elmira, on Friday, April 29, 2022 at 1:30 p.m. Committal services at Woodlawn National Cemetery will follow.
